#8f598f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#8f598f is composed of 56.1% red, 34.9%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 43.9% black. It has a hue angle of 300 degrees, a saturation of 23.3% and a lightness of 45.5%. #8f598f color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b2ff with #1f001f. Closest websafe color is: #996699.

Shades and Tints of #8f598f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a060a is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#8f598f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#747474 is the less saturated color, while #df09df is the most saturated one.
